CVE-2020-15335: High severity zyxel cloud cnm secumanager vulnerability
Zyxel CloudCNM SecuManager 3.1.0 and 3.1.1 has no authentication for /registerCpe requests.

What is the severity of CVE-2020-15335?
The severity of CVE-2020-15335 is high with a severity value of 7.5.
Which software versions are affected by CVE-2020-15335?
Zyxel CloudCNM SecuManager versions 3.1.0 and 3.1.1 are affected by CVE-2020-15335.
How does CVE-2020-15335 impact Zyxel CloudCNM SecuManager?
CVE-2020-15335 allows unauthorized access to the /registerCpe endpoint of Zyxel CloudCNM SecuManager without authentication.
